Section 15
Punishment For Claiming False Designation
Whoever, either a public
servant or any other person falsely claims that he/she holds any position,
power, capacity or facility or enjoys such position, power, capacity or facility
of a public servant which he/she is not entitled to or displays any symbol, dress
or mark relating to a position of a public servant or wears or displays any
object resembling to such symbol, dress or mark with the intention of
leading others to falsely believe that these are the official symbols, dresses
or marks of a public servant, shall be liable to a punishment of
imprisonment for a term from one year to two years and with a fine from
fifty thousand to one hundred thousand rupees, depending on the degree
of the offence committed.
